The Company

Páramo Directional Clothing designs and distributes durable garments for outdoor people, using unique and superior fabric systems to keep them comfortable in extreme environments. The products are indefinitely renewable using Nikwax® aftercare and their innovative design allows the garments to be recycled at the end of their useable lifetime.

We develop our products in-house, from the headquarters in Wadhurst, East Sussex, with the garments manufactured at The Miquelina Foundation in Bogotá, Colombia. This partnership started in 1992 and has assisted over 10,000 vulnerable women to find a better life, away from prostitution or exploitative situations. With Páramo’s support, the factory has carried the World Fair Trade label since 2017.

We have an ongoing dedication to minimising our impact on the environment and a devoted group of people to help develop the business. Páramo is employee owned, which will protect and build upon our purpose and values, whilst securing a bright future for all employee owners.
